This property is a superbly crafted Mews home in a converted water mill with an idyllic rural location on The River Mole at Betchworth. The property has a spacious reception hall with oak flooring and understairs storage, a cloakroom with heated towel rail, and a living room with a superb outlook to the front over the river. The kitchen/dining room features solid wood, limed-oak fronts, a composite sink, and a range of high-end appliances. On the first floor, there is a master bedroom with a Velux skylight, an en-suite shower room with a corner shower cubicle, and three further bedrooms with Velux skylights and eaves storage cupboards. The property also features a main bathroom, a basement storage area, and undercover car parking. The grounds extend around the front, sides, and rear of the mill pond with footpaths leading into the countryside, and there is a communal area with a residents' washing line. The property has underfloor heating derived from the mill pond via a water-source heat pump system.
